INTRODUCTION TO PYTHON
PROGRAMMING LANGUAGE
1.
Python is currently the most popular programming language and also the fastest
growing one. The concept of Python was introduced in 1989 and it is being used widely
in machine learning, data science, and artificial intelligence.
Python is used by big companies like Facebook and Twitter for managing and
processing large amounts of data.
The language is easy to learn and has a wide range of applications. It supports multiple
paradigms including object-oriented, procedural, and functional programming.
Python has been used in almost every area of programming, including by big companies
like Google and YouTube.
The language is open source and has a huge community with many inbuilt packages,
modules, and functions that can be used in programs without having to write them from
scratch.
Python has many discussion forums where users can post queries and get answers.
Frameworks like Django and Flask are available for web development.
